New Delhi, December 8 (IANS). Congress leader Sukhjinder Singh Randhawa has hit back at the statement of Navjot Singh Sidhu’s wife Navjot Kaur Sidhu, in which she said that the post of Chief Minister in Congress is possible only if at least Rs 500 crore is given in the suitcase.
On this statement of Navjot, Randhawa said that Congress is not in danger from anyone in Punjab, but there is definitely danger from such people.
Congress leader Sukhjinder Singh Randhawa, while interacting with the media in New Delhi, took a dig at Navjot Kaur Sidhu’s statement that when she joined Congress from BJP, she was later made a minister. He should tell how much money he had to pay to become a minister. Randhawa said that she became the second minister in the government after the Chief Minister. After that he was made PCC President. If you become president, tell me how much money you had to pay. We went with them and stayed with them. But, now what does such a statement mean?
He said that the Chief Minister of the state is inferior to the party president. Navjot should tell how much money he gave when he was made the state president. He said that our workers are with the people for their welfare, in the last three years our workers faced lathicharge, where were you then. He said that there is no threat to Congress in Punjab, but there is danger with people like Navzor Kaur.
At the same time, Congress national spokesperson Surendra Rajput targeted Navjot Kaur Sidhu and said that after falling ill, she might have lost her mental balance due to the effect of medicines. They need a good doctor. Be it Navjot Kaur Sidhu or Navjot Singh Sidhu, both of them came to the Congress party from the Bharatiya Janata Party. So was he staying in BJP with a briefcase? Navjot Kaur Sidhu should know that it was she who never got tired of praising Congress. If the medicines have had a mental effect after the illness, then there is no need to worry or react too much on such people.
